KCRV-FM (105.1 FM) is a radio station licensed to Caruthersville, Missouri, United States. The station is currently owned by Pollack Broadcasting Co.[1]

History

The station was assigned the call letters KCRV-FM on May 19, 1981. On January 2, 1984, the station changed its call sign to KLOW, on March 21, 2003 to the current KCRV-FM.[2] [3]
